Transaction 3e19515c57621201cc3f3890de1e16eda697dfc151bc840c5723bd35df95f6ae
1 Input
1 Output
-
3e19515c57621201cc3f3890de1e16eda697dfc151bc840c5723bd35df95f6ae:0
- value
- 499000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bf522a982920f88def77862e99492af4ad89639 OP_EQUALVERIFY OP_CHECKSIG
- address
- 151RiZBSe4sychyUKd5469DPiAWYDimgKs